What is the optimal tilt angle of PV panel for Chandigarh region?

In the present work, the study on the optimal tilt angle of the PV panel for the Chandigarh region has been done. It can be seen that the tilt angle for winter is greater than in summer due to the position of the sun in the sky. It has also been found that the annual tilt angle for the region varies approximately 26–28°.

What is the optimal angle for a PV system?

In all years and in all regions the optimal azimuth is pointing south (180 ± 3°) and optimal tilt angles are between 30° and 45° depending on the latitude of the site. Why do fixed PV panels need tilt angle?

Therefore, fixed PV installations with a well-engineered tilt angle are still prevalent in PV industry . The optimum performance of a PV panel depends on the amount of incident solar radiation on it. So, a panel needs to be inclined in such an angle that maximum sunrays intercept its top surface vertically.

What is the optimum tilt angle and azimuth angle for solar panels?

Rowlands et al. modeled and determined solar radiation data and analyzed PV panel performance in Canada. The optimum tilt angle was seen quite lower than latitude of 45°, and the azimuth angle was close due south.
